无法创建VPN连接?别慌!网络工程师教你一步步排查与解决
在现代远程办公、跨国协作日益普遍的背景下,虚拟私人网络(VPN)已成为我们访问企业内网、保护隐私和绕过地理限制的重要工具,许多用户常遇到“无法创建VPN连接”的问题,这不仅影响工作效率,还可能引发安全疑虑,作为一名经验丰富的网络工程师,我将为你系统性地梳理常见原因,并提供可操作的解决方案。
明确问题本质:是客户端配置错误?服务器端故障?还是网络环境限制?我们需要分步骤排查。
第一步:检查本地网络连接
确保你的设备已成功接入互联网,打开命令提示符(Windows)或终端(macOS/Linux),输入 ping 8.8.8.8 测试外网连通性,若无响应,说明基础网络异常,应重启路由器、更换网线或联系ISP(互联网服务提供商)确认是否有断网或限速情况。
第二步:验证VPN配置正确性
如果你使用的是公司或第三方提供的OpenVPN、IPsec、WireGuard等协议,请仔细核对以下信息:
- 服务器地址是否准确(vpn.example.com 或 IP 地址)
- 用户名/密码是否输入无误(注意大小写)
- 端口号是否开放(如UDP 1194用于OpenVPN)
- 配置文件是否完整导入(尤其在手机或Mac上易遗漏证书)
第三步:防火墙与杀毒软件干扰
Windows Defender防火墙、第三方杀毒软件(如卡巴斯基、360)可能拦截VPN流量,临时关闭它们测试是否恢复连接,若可行,则需在防火墙中添加例外规则,允许相关程序(如OpenVPN GUI)通过。
第四步:检查服务器状态与认证机制
如果是企业内网VPN,联系IT部门确认:
- VPN服务器是否在线(可通过ping或telnet测试端口)
- 账户是否被锁定或过期
- 是否启用双因素认证(2FA)而你未完成第二步验证
第五步:操作系统兼容性问题
某些旧版本Windows(如Win7)或移动系统(Android/iOS)可能因SSL/TLS协议不匹配导致握手失败,更新操作系统、安装最新版客户端,或切换至支持更强加密算法的配置。
第六步:高级诊断工具
使用 tracert(Windows)或 traceroute(Linux/macOS)查看数据包路径是否中断;用Wireshark抓包分析是否存在TCP重传、TLS握手失败等底层问题。
最后提醒:如果以上方法均无效,可能是ISP封禁了特定端口(如运营商屏蔽了443端口的OpenVPN),此时建议尝试更换端口(如改用UDP 53或TCP 443)、使用Obfsproxy混淆技术,或联系专业团队协助分析日志。
网络问题往往不是单一原因造成,耐心排查才能高效解决,别让一次“无法创建VPN连接”成为你工作的绊脚石——掌握这些技巧,你也能成为自己的网络专家!




